The much-anticipated Redditch Tuesday Netball league has made a thrilling return, with fans treated to an action-packed first week of the new season in the League.
Shooting off the season with impressive performances, the Betty's Comets outshone the Redditch Rockets with a 27-13 victory. The Comets displayed an exceptional display of teamwork and strategy, dominating the match from the get-go and asserting their might in the League.
In another hard-fought battle of the night, the Ball Hoggers proved too strong for The Tenacious 7, claiming a notable 24-7 victory. The Hoggers demonstrated their sheer dominance on the court, setting an early benchmark for the rest of the season.
The Rebels also started their season campaign on a high, proving their mettle with a 20-15 win over the Goal Divas, in what was a nail-biting confrontation.
The highlight of the week, however, was the stellar performance of Elizabeth Hill from Redditch Rockets. Despite her team's result, Hill emerged as the most valued player of the week, showcasing her exceptional skills and sportsmanship throughout the game.
